About The Embry-Riddle Center For Aerospace Resilient Systems
ERAU's Center for Aerospace Resilient Systems (CARS) is the Embry-Riddle wide research center dedicated to advancing aviation and aerospace resilient systems, focusing on aerospace cybersecurity and AI/ML challenges. CARS is committed to collaborating with industry and government partners, providing innovative solutions to pressing resilience challenges. The Center's work spans a broad spectrum of systems-related domains such as: aviation & aerospace cybersecurity including cutting-edge tools for enhancing cybersecurity in the operational technology (OT) domains, artificial intelligence / machine learning (AI / ML) and data science / data analytics, software engineering, advanced air mobility (AAM) and unmanned aerial systems (UAS) technologies, human-machine interfaces, virtual and augmented reality training systems, airspace/airport simulation & modeling, and civil aviation airspace systems.
The Center also maintains a vast historical Air Traffic database (archived since 1999). CARS is at the forefront of driving resilient systems innovation to foster a safe, secure, and resilient future of the aviation and aerospace ecosystem.
